SPECIFICATIONS:
Part Number 14598
Cut–in Voltage 13V
Cut–out Voltage 14.2V
Max. Solar Rating 105 W / 7amps
Weight 3.6 oz (0.1kg)
Size w/o cables 3 5/8 x 2 1/2 x 1 in
(9.2075 x 6.35 x 2.54 cm)
Cable length 11 1/4 in (286 mm)
The SCC can be used with any P3 Portable
Power Pack from Global Solar Energy and is
designed specifically to connect to the P3 solar
packs for continuous charging. Using the P3
solar pack and the Solar Charge Controller will
help maintain the battery in a fully charged
state. The charge light on the SCC indicates
charging. The fully charged light indicates when
charging is complete.
CHARGING FEATURES:
• GREEN light indicates battery is full
• When battery reaches
14.2V, the
SCC will cut
out thereby
ensuring no
overcharging
of the battery
• YELLOW light indicates solar
panel is
charging battery
• When battery is below 13V, the SCC will allow charging to start.
NOTE: It is normal for both lights to flicker in
and out during normal operation.
TIPS FOR USE:
• Solar Charge Controller should be placed within 5 feet of the battery and in a dry,
well ventilated area
• This Solar Charge Controller can support up to 105 watts of power. It is not
advisable to use with greater wattage
• All connections should be in parallel to ensure 12V- positive to positive, negative
to negative
SOLAR CHARGE CONTROLLER
APPLICATIONS/HOW TO USE
CAUTION: Ensure that you completely understand
this instruction manual before using the Solar Charge
Controller.
1. For 12V Car Battery
Application: Use SCC with P3 solar pack to
trickle charge car batteries.
Recommended use: Connect 8′ extension accessory cable to solar panel, then to the
SAE plug on the SCC marked SOLAR (Fig.1 & Fig. 2). Connect SAE plug from SCC marked BATTERY to battery clamp
accessory cable (Fig. 2). Attach red battery clamp to positive (+) car battery terminal and
black battery clamp to negative (-) car
battery terminal.
Fig. 1
Fig. 2
WARNING: Attaching battery clamps in reverse polarity could result in shocks, burns or permanent damage to the
car battery or solar panel.
2. For cell phones and other devices
Application: To charge cell phones and other
devices
Recommended use: Connect solar panel
directly to SAE plug on the SCC marked
SOLAR (or connect to 8′ extension cable and then to SCC marked SOLAR). Connect
SAE plug from SCC marked BATTERY to
cigarette lighter adapter receptacle
accessory cable or barrel tip accessory
cable and connect to cell phone or electronic
device for charging.
TROUBLESHOOTING
Always test outdoors under optimal sunlight
conditions.
• Inspect the connections between P3 Folding Solar Power Panel and the SCC.
• Inspect all plugs, outlets, clamps, connectors and cables to ensure they are not damaged
or cut.
• If the connections are all secure, use a volt meter or 12V test light to check voltage
between the positive and negative
electrodes. This check should be done
using the 12V vehicle power plug. Open
voltage can range from 16V to 24V.
• If battery voltage is 14.2 or higher, the GREEN light should be on. If battery voltage
is between 13 and 14.2, the YELLOW light
should be on. If battery voltage is 13 or
lower, the YELLOW light should be on.
• For vehicle battery charging, check to make sure that the battery is in good condition.
Over time battery performance decreases
the battery may need to be replaced.
NOTE: Some vehicle batteries require more power
(current) than the solar power panel purchased. If
problems persist you may require a larger solar power
panel.
FAQs
How many panels can I connect to my 7
AMP SCC?
You can connect up to 105 Watts of solar
power to the SCC. Panels should be connected
in parallel – positive to positive, negative to
negative.
When will the Charging indication light
(green) light up?
The charging indication green light will light up
when the battery voltage reaches 14.2 Volts
and the SCC will prevent the solar panels from
overcharging the battery. It is normal for the
SCC charging light to flicker on and off as the
battery voltage cuts in and out.
